The First National-Level Overseas Project with TVTC in Saudi Arabia

The First National-Level Overseas Project with TVTC in Saudi Arabia

We partnered with Saudi Arabia's Technical and Vocational Training Corporation (TVTC) to build a virtual simulation training center at the Medina First Industrial Secondary Institute. The center was inaugurated by Dr. Sultan Al Ghamdi, Governor of TVTC, reflecting strong institutional support for digital training and virtual simulation in vocational education.

As our first overseas cooperation with a national-level vocational education institution, the project covers simulation-based teaching, practical training, and assessment. The center combines our T1 glasses-free 3D terminals with R1 86-inch 3D interactive whiteboards. T1 supports detailed structure visualization and individual practice, while R1 enables classroom demonstrations and group learning for dozens of students.

This project marks an important milestone in the MENA region and demonstrates how virtual simulation can support the digital upgrade of vocational education in Saudi Arabia.

CTE Pilot with Casper College in the United States

Invited by the University of Wyoming's CTE project team, We visited Casper College in Wyoming during the 2026 SkillsUSA competition and established a pilot partnership for virtual simulation in Career and Technical Education (CTE).

The pilot covers multiple vocational disciplines, including mechanical manufacturing, automotive repair, and anatomy. In addition, the project also explores the use of virtual simulation as an innovative teaching tool in teacher education and training programs.

By combining T1 glasses-free 3D devices with virtual simulation content, the pilot enables teachers and students to better understand complex structures and technical concepts while improving classroom interaction and practical training efficiency. The collaboration also lays the foundation for our future expansion within regional CTE systems in the United States.

First K12 CTE Classroom Pilot in the U.S.

Bingham High School marks our first K12 CTE classroom pilot in the United States. The pilot helped our better understand U.S. high school CTE classrooms, student needs, and localization requirements.

During the session, students used our T1 glasses-free 3D devices to experience modules such as Mechanical Drawing and Automotive Engine. The feedback was highly positive: over 90% of students said 3D visualization made complex structures easier to understand, and most students supported this new immersive learning experience.

Based on feedback from teachers and students, We further improved its course localization, teaching flow, and content presentation. This is a key part of our overseas strategy: adapting its solutions through real classroom feedback to better fit local education systems.
